Output 143058ad8299c6c29eb8d8e94cde0e0026dadd979b15faf9cc3ea61b6221b584:0

value
9903783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acf131921cefcb0fcc4bc154a7e16d8081a90e53 OP_EQUAL
address
MPfbPrQVYCafWfFwEgfsaDqC3geJf8fryJ
transaction
143058ad8299c6c29eb8d8e94cde0e0026dadd979b15faf9cc3ea61b6221b584
spent
true